Renters Insurance You Can Count On
Renters insurance may seem like the least of your concerns, and you're wondering if you really need it. But imagine how much it would cost to replace all the belongings in your rented apartment. State Farm's Renters insurance can help when windstorms or tornadoes damage your valuables.
